Description
Born on December 18, 2036, at Grace Field House Plantation 3, Nat lived as an orphan under Isabella's care. Identified by the neck tattoo "30294", he ranked as high-quality "merchandise" for his intellect and age. He had short auburn hair, brown eyes in the manga (red in the anime), and prided himself on his prominent nose.

His personality fused extroversion, narcissism, and emotional vulnerability. Jovial and fun-loving, he mingled easily, peppering conversations with sarcasm. This sociability contrasted starkly with his cowardice around insects, reptiles, or intimidating figures like Sonju. He expressed emotions transparently—crying from joy during reunions or when siblings healed, and readily showing fear or discomfort. Despite occasional pessimism, he demonstrated creativity, musical talent, and perceptiveness. Skilled in piano and accordion, he led performances for events like Norman's birthday and taught music to younger siblings. He also cut hair expertly, and blancmange remained his favorite food.

Nat maintained close bonds with fellow Grace Field escapees, especially peers Anna, Thoma, and Lannion, while protecting younger children. His friendship with Anna stood out; they were frequently together due to shared age and upbringing. Moments hinted at romantic interest in Anna, though he denied it when questioned. Relationships with elders varied: he embraced Yugo's nickname "Nose" as a compliment but found Sonju frightening.

Initially oblivious to the orphanage's true purpose, he learned its horrific reality alongside Anna, Thoma, and Lannion via Don and Gilda's revelation. He aided escape preparations, helping Don secure cliff-crossing zip lines. On January 15, 2046, he fled Grace Field with fourteen other children over five.

Survival in the Promised Forest tested him. Hunting with Don, he avoided reptiles and bugs to catch birds. He struggled with unfamiliar foods, dodging Gilda's suspicious fish stew. Wild demon encounters triggered visible terror, and finding dead animals shocked him. Despite fears, his observational skills and cautious remarks often prompted group reassessments. Mujika and Sonju provided refuge, teaching vital survival skills.

The group discovered Shelter B06-32, where Nat played piano during a month of stability before pursuers and wild demons forced another flight. They took temporary refuge in a temple near a demon village.

Reaching Paradise Hideout, Nat celebrated amenities like proper toilets. He reacted with visible shock and joy upon reuniting with Norman. Initially backing Norman's demon-eradication plan, he ultimately supported Emma's non-violent approach for peace. Later, he joined the mission rescuing remaining Grace Field children.

Entering the human world opened a new chapter. He showed visible worry over Emma's post-journey disappearance. Over two years, he adapted to human society—attending school and focusing on music studies. By spring 2049, he tearfully reunited with Emma despite her amnesia. Subsequent years saw him fulfill his opera-appreciation dream. Physically, he grew to 142 cm at age 11 and 156 cm at 13, adopting a mature appearance with longer, messier hair and trading his uniform for black pants and a white shirt.
